EKG Gadu 1.9~pre+r2855-3+b1 contains a local buffer overflow vulnerability in the username handling that allows local attackers to execute arbitrary code by supplying an oversized username string. Attackers can trigger the overflow in the strlcpy function by passing a crafted buffer exceeding 258 bytes to overwrite the instruction pointer and execute shellcode with user privileges.
